Rhino is available for download both in source and compiled form.
You can download binary distributions of Rhino from ftp://ftp.mozilla.org/pub/mozilla.org/js/ . These zip files includes precompiled js.jar with all Rhino classes, documentation, examples and sources.
Rhino 1.6R2 is the last qualified release. It includes support for ECMAScript for XML (E4X). To implement E4X runtime Rhino uses XMLBeans library and if you would like to use E4X you need to add xbean.jar from XMLBeans distribution to your class path.

If you are looking for js.jar for XSLT or for IBM's Bean Scripting Framework (BSF), please read the following note and then download one of the zip files above and unzip it.
cvs co mozilla/js/rhinoto get the tip source.
The current tip can also be viewed using LXR at http://lxr.mozilla.org/mozilla/source/js/rhino/ . See also change log for the current tip.
Rhino uses Ant as its build system and running ant command at the top directory of Rhino distribution should print the list of available build targets.
